首页 文章

如何更改mysql的ft_boolean_syntax?

提问于
浏览
0

我想通过调整变量ft_boolean_syntax来改变MariaDB / MySQL的搜索行为以与Phabricator一起使用 .

正如Phabricator所说

要更改此设置,请将其添加到my.cnf文件(在[mysqld]部分中),然后重新启动mysqld:ft_boolean_syntax ='| - > <()〜*:“”&^'

我试图更改my.cnf文件,但mysql不会从这些更改开始 .

systemctl status mysql.service

回报

[ERROR] Invalid ft-boolean-syntax string:

在我看来,MySQL只能看到ft_boolean_string的第一个字符(这是一个空格) .

MariaDB / MySQL版本:

mysql Ver 15.1 Distrib 10.0.21-MariaDB, for Linux (x86_64) using readline 5.1

任何想法如何解决这个问题?

1 回答

  • 1

    我找到了更改MySQL文档中的值的规则:

    如果要更改ft_boolean_syntax,替换值必须为14个字符 - source

相关问题